Alfonso “Al” Sollecito was born on July 26, 1934, in Brooklyn, New York. He was predeceased by his parents, Mary and Vincent, and his six siblings. He is survived by his beloved wife of 66 years, Millie (nee Livoti); his 4 children, Mary Lynn (Luke), Lucia (Keith), Vincent, and Madelyn (Paul); 11 grandchildren, John (Sage), …
